Shooting for Gold: Winter's Last Frontier

Episode Summary

US Biathletes Clare Egan and Lowell Bailey take us into the riveting world of global biathlon and explain why their underdog adaptability might be the best chance for the United States' first Olympic medal in the sport.

Episode Notes

Biathlon is a fan-filled, high-drama and celebrity-making sport, just not in the US. And yet Amercian biathletes are etching their way into the competitive landscape abroad with every rifle shot and ski stroke. 

 

Lowell Bailey, director of high performance at US Biathlon and current competitor Clare Egan take contrast their stateside and European realities and give us insight into the last winter olympic sport their nation has yet to medal in.
